How purchase now, pay later works

Purchase now, pay later helps you to take residence your purchasing now and break up the cost over just a few weeks or months.

Many of the large names declare to be “interest-free” so long as you pay on time. Some retailers provide even longer reimbursement plans with fastened month-to-month funds.

It sounds innocent sufficient. You get the gadgets you want immediately, keep away from an enormous one-off hit to your checking account, and pay it off little by little.

However there’s a catch. In case you miss a cost or overlook about just a few completely different instalments, the cash you owe can construct up – and quick. Belief me, I naively acquired caught up like this years in the past.

Late charges can apply, and whereas not each supplier stories missed funds, extra are beginning to, which implies it may possibly have an effect on your credit score file and make it more durable to get finance in a while.

It additionally blurs the road between what you can afford and what you ought to afford. When there’s no upfront cost, it’s simple to spend greater than you deliberate with out actually noticing.

Why it’s riskier at Christmas

There’s no time of 12 months with extra strain to spend than Christmas. You wish to give your children a beautiful day, deal with your loved ones, and sustain with everybody else.

Outlets know this too, which is why purchase now, pay later provides are in every single place proper now.

The hazard comes when these little “£20 right here, £30 there” purchases begin stacking up.

By the point the payments hit in January, together with larger power prices and common month-to-month bills, your checking account could be beneath actual pressure.

Many individuals additionally take out multiple purchase now, pay later plan throughout completely different retailers, which makes it more durable to maintain observe of what’s due and when.

There’s additionally the emotional facet. Paying later means you don’t really feel the ache of spending immediately. You persuade your self that you simply’ll take care of it subsequent month, however that’s precisely how the debt builds.

The hidden prices to be careful for

Even when the deal says no curiosity, that doesn’t imply it’s cost-free. Some corporations cost late charges, others use debt collectors for missed funds, and the method can really feel tense if you happen to fall behind.

Returns may cause issues, too. In case you ship one thing again however the refund takes some time, you may nonetheless need to make the subsequent cost earlier than the refund clears.

This may result in confusion, overdraft prices, or missed instalments, which can depart a mark in your account.

And if you happen to’re utilizing a bank card to repay your purchase now, pay later plan, you can be paying curiosity twice, as soon as to your card supplier and once more via missed BNPL funds.

And, you’re not truly paying it off; you’re simply bouncing debt from one place to a different.

It’s a slippery slope, particularly when a number of small money owed are sitting within the background.

Higher methods to handle Christmas prices

If you wish to unfold the fee safely, there are nonetheless choices.

Some supermarkets run Christmas financial savings golf equipment the place you may pay in small quantities all year long and earn a bonus. It’s too late for this 12 months, but it surely’s price becoming a member of after Christmas for subsequent time.

For now, take into consideration establishing a small “Christmas pot” in your financial institution app. Monzo, Starling and Chase all allow you to set cash apart mechanically.

Even shifting just a few kilos per week helps you intend forward with out counting on credit score.

Cashback apps and grocery store rewards may also enable you to minimize prices on meals, drink and presents. Websites like TopCashback, Quidco and grocery store loyalty playing cards all add up when used usually.

In case you’re actually struggling, have a look at native schemes and charities providing assist with necessities this winter. They’re there to take a few of the strain off, not choose you for asking.
